COVID-NOW NHS Oncology Workforce study: 2nd Survey NOW OPEN

Are you a UK NHS employee working within an oncology hospital department?

Would you like to contribute to some important research exploring the impact of COVID-19 on the oncology workforce?

 

What is the research about?

The purpose of the research is to:

Understand the experiences of NHS oncology staff
Understand what factors might influence wellbeing, burnout and coping
Understand what changes and support should be offered to help support the oncology workforce during COVID-19 and beyond

What does taking part involve?

Complete a short, anonymous survey by 23rd April. It should take around 15 minutes to complete and can very done on a phone, tablet or computer.

 

To access the survey all you need to do it follow the link here:
COVID-NOW T2 SURVEY

 

We plan to have a further survey this year to track experiences and the longer term impact of COVID-19 in the NHS oncology workforce.

Who is carrying out the Research?

The study sponsor is The Royal Marsden NHS Foundation Trust (Chief Investigator Dr Susana Banerjee). The academic collaboration includes researchers at Lancaster University.

The study (HRA approved) is funded by the Royal Marsden Cancer Charity (donation from Lady Garden Foundation) and is supported by The Association of Cancer Physicians (ACP), Faculty of Clinical Oncology of the Royal College of Radiologists (RCR) and British Oncology Pharmacy Association (BOPA).
